Lunchtime Concert - Through a Different Lens

Niki Vasilakis  violin
Lucinda Collins  piano

Ravel  Cinq mélodies populaires grecques
Tchaikovsky  Souvenir d’un lieu cher for Violin and Piano
Mozart  Violin and Piano  Sonata No. 26 in B-flat major K. 378 (317d)

Jazz and blues strongly influenced Ravel’s arrangement of folk songs from the island of Chios off Turkey. The three pieces of Tchaikovsky’s Souvenir d’un lieu cher are built on Russian folk-inspired melodies, the first of which, Méditation, was originally intended as the second movement of his great violin concerto. Mozart's Sonata in B-flat major is a captivating musical dialogue between the violin and piano, showcasing his mastery of melody and interplay between the two instruments.
